A significant patch for SUSE targeting a vulnerability related to service interruptions within libtirpc has just been released for systems that may be impacted.
An update that fixes one vulnerability is now available

Summary

This update for libtirpc fixes the following issues: - CVE-2021-46828: Fixed denial of service vulnerability with lots of connections (bsc#1201680). Patch Instructions: To install this SUSE Security Update use the SUSE recommended installation methods like YaST online_update or "zypper patch".
